Jose Urquidy – Pitches/Start: 71 | Strike %: 66.9 | Pitches per out: 5.3 | Game Score: 40

There’s an argument to be made that Urquidy pitched in some bad luck Sunday.  Sure, the Mariners erupted for five runs in the fourth, but one hit was a ball off the glove of Alex Bregman and another one that Yuli Gurriel should have handled and then a bomb.

Still, the Mariners were teeing off on Urquidy and he ended up with the worst game score of the first nine.

Not only that, but despite the fact that he walked only one and threw almost 66% strikes, Urquidy wasn’t efficient at all early and ended up giving up eight hits in four innings.

A solid first start, followed by a poor second leads to a below average first two starts. Urquidy throws strikes, but the Mariners squared many of them up and 5.3 pitches per out is about average on this staff at this point of the season.
